IGP Jammu reviews Security arrangements for Republic Day-2019
1/19/2019 10:44:37 PM
Early Times Report

Jammu, Jan 19 : M. K. Sinha, Inspector General of Police , Jammu Zone, Jammu, held a meeting with all Stake holders at Conference Hall, Police Control Room, Jammu to discuss the Police/Security arrangements required to be made for the celebration of Republic Day-2019.
M. K. Sinha, IGP, Jammu Zone, Jammu, stressed upon all the officers that proper briefing be given to the officers/ Officials deployed for Republic Day duties in view of threat of terror attacks and frequent ceasefire violations from across the border.
He stressed upon all the participants for effective and co-ordinated efforts at gross root level for smooth conduct of the function. IGP Jammu Zone reviewed a security arrangement that has already been made in and around the venue and arrangements that shall be made on the day of the Republic Day function at Sports Stadium University, Jammu.
He stressed on proper and intensive foot patrolling and surveillance of the areas in and around the sports stadium, University, Jammu, Checking of Hotels and other lodgements on continuous basis, joint nakas that have been established at select places in border areas so that ANE/ASE trying to sneak in the city are intercepted in border area.
He further directed all the intelligence agencies and SSP Jammu to activate their all their resources available with them to generate intelligence having bearing on Republic Day-2019 in advance so that anti-national and anti-social elements do not succeed in their nefarious designs.
He reviewed the parking arrangements for the function so that vehicles are parked in an orderly manner and stressed that traffic arrangements be made in such a manner that general public does not get inconvenienced.
